Night Arrow6-2 The ATN Night Arrow 6 - 2 from ATN is a rugged night vision riflescope that provides excellent observation, target acquisition and aiming capabilities for the demanding sports shooter or varmint hunter.

The best optics, tubes and performance make the ATN night arrow 6 - 2 one of the best commercial NV Weapon Scopes!

Features:

- Light and compact design
- Top-notch performance
- All external surfaces are a non-reflective matte black finish (except for the optical elements)
- “Red on Green” reticle system with 1/6 MOA adjustment
- One-knob operation
- Automatic brightness control(ABC) for tube protection
- Illuminated center red reticle for optimal contrast against a dark or light target
- Mounts to standard weaver rails
- Night Arrow is designed to use 1 AA type battery

Specifications:

- Total Darkness IR System: Yes
- "SMART" Technology: No
- IIT Generation: 2
- Photocathode Type: Multi - Alkali
- Resolution: 45-54 lp/mm
- Signal to Noise Ratio: 12-20
- Figure of Merit: <1250
- MTTF (Mean Time Before Failure): 5,000
- Magnification: 6x
- Proshield Lens Coating: Yes
- FOV: 5°
- Exit Pupil: 11mm
- Eye Relief: 46mm
- Range of Focus: 10 m to infinity
- Diopter Adjustment: -4 to +6
- Controls: Direct
- Remote Control: No
- Automatic Brightness Control: Yes
- Bright Light Cut-off: Yes
- Infrared Illuminator: Detachable IR450
- IR Indicator: Yes
- Low Battery Indicator: Yes (in FOV)
- Power Supply: 1 x 1.5 V AA type battery
- Battery Life: 30 Hours
- Reticle System: Red on Green
- Windage & Elevation Adjustment: 1/6 MOA
- Environmental Rating: Water and fog resistant
- MIL-STD-810: No
- Operating Temperature: -40 to +50 °C
- Storage Temperature: -50 to +70 °C
- Dimensions: 335 x 103 x 93mm / 13.2" x 4.1" x 3.7"
- Weight: 1.7 kg / 3.8 lbs
